Ocean Thermal Energy Days Sales Outstanding Calculation

Days Sales Outstanding measures the average number of days that a company takes to collect revenue after a sale has been made. It is a financial ratio that illustrates how well a company's Accounts Receivable are being managed.

Accounts Receivable can be measured by Days Sales Outstanding.

Ocean Thermal Energy's Days Sales Outstanding for the fiscal year that ended in Dec. 2025 is calculated as

Days Sales Outstanding (A: Dec. 2025 )
=Average Accounts Receivable /Revenue*Days in Period
=( (Accounts Receivable (A: Dec. 2024 ) + Accounts Receivable (A: Dec. 2025 )) / count ) / Revenue (A: Dec. 2025 )*Days in Period
=( (0 + 1.076) / 1 ) / 3.014*365
=1.076 / 3.014*365
=130.31

Ocean Thermal Energy Business Description

Address 3675 Market Street, Suite 200, Philadelphia, PA, USA, 19104
Ocean Thermal Energy Corp is engaged in the business of developing designs for renewable energy systems using Ocean Thermal Energy Conversion (OTEC) technology. OTEC uses the natural temperature difference between cooler deep ocean water and warmer shallow or surface water to create energy and produce electricity. The company also aims to develop projects for renewable power generation, desalinated water production, and air conditioning using the proprietary technologies designed to extract energy from the temperature differences between warm surface water and cold deep water. In addition, the projects provide ancillary products such as potable/bottled water and high-profit aquaculture, mariculture, and agriculture opportunities.
